#2 Samoa Joe

Samoa Joe has finally made it to WWE's top table. The Destroyer has travelled the world wrestling for almost every single promotion under the sun. The only place left to conquer was WWE, and he's well on his way to achieving that final goal.
What's a real shame is that ECW is no longer around for Joe to showcase his aggressive style of pro wrestling. Through his work with Brock Lesnar alone earlier this year, it's likely that Paul Heyman was watching him from his front row seat and wishing the Samoan had been born twenty years sooner.

Joe also bears a remarkable resemblance in both appearance and wrestling style to one of ECW's greatest ever performers, Taz. The Brooklyn native was one of the revolutionary promotion's greatest assets, and it's plain to see that Joe has taken a lot of inspiration from the former announcer.
